How To Choose The Best Blue Colored Landscape Rocks

Selecting the right blue rock involves more than just picking your favorite shade. You need to match the material to the location, the weight to the coverage area, and the durability to the weather conditions. Below are the key factors to weigh before you buy.

Material: Glass vs. Natural Stone vs. Resin

Fire glass offers the highest reflectivity and comes tempered for heat resistance, making it ideal for fire pits and modern planters. Natural river rocks provide an organic look with subtle color variations, but they may arrive dusty and require washing. Resin stepping stones are lightweight and hand-painted, best for decorative paths or wall plaques where you want a defined image rather than bulk fill.

Color Integrity and Safety

For glass products, premium tempering locks the color in so it does not fade or turn black under high heat. Natural stones can look dramatically different when wet versus dry, so check owner photos before committing. If the stones will sit near an open flame, confirm the material is rated for high temperature and is smokeless and soot-free.

Hardware & Specs Guide

Fire Glass Tempering

Premium fire glass undergoes a high-temperature tempering process that locks color into the core of each bead. This prevents fading, discoloration, and cracking when exposed to direct flame. Non-tempered glass may cloud or pop over time. Always look for “tempered” or “heat resistant to 800°C+” in the specifications.
